Background:
- Video-assisted thoracoscopic surgery (VATS) has emerged as a less invasive alternative to traditional thoracotomy.
- Its application in diverse thoracic pathologies requires ongoing evaluation.
Purpose of the Study:
- To evaluate the efficacy and patient outcomes of VATS for a range of thoracic conditions.
- To highlight the benefits of VATS in terms of patient recovery and experience.
Main Methods:
- Retrospective analysis of 20 patients undergoing VATS between December 1992 and an unspecified date.
- Procedures included wedge resection for lung tumors, lobectomy for tracheaectasy, treatment for recurrent spontaneous pneumothorax, pleural tumor resection, pulmonary cyst removal, and lung biopsy.
Main Results:
- Successful treatment was achieved in all 11 cases of recurrent spontaneous pneumothorax.
- VATS was utilized for lung tumors (n=3), tracheaectasy (n=1), pleural tumors (n=1), pulmonary cysts (n=1), and lung biopsies (n=3).
- Patient demographics: 16 males, 4 females; age range 20-65 years.
Conclusions:
- VATS provides significant advantages including improved cosmetics, reduced operative time, and decreased postoperative pain.
- Earlier patient mobilization and shorter recovery periods are key benefits of this minimally invasive technique.
